**Vendor note: Inkmill markdown pipeline**

Rendering for Parchway docs is outsourced to Inkmill under an annual contract, renewing each March. They handle sanitization and PDF export; we own the upload queue. SLA: 4-hour response on rendering failures. Escalate only after two failed retries. Their support desk is reachable at the address below.

billing contact of hahaf-baguf = zorael.tammir.jorius@sivrelhq.internal

Teams still running legacy cron jobs should register them in the migration tracker; unregistered jobs will not get conversion support and are scheduled for decommission next quarter. Converted workflows get standard on-call coverage; legacy crons do not. Common issues — missed schedules, retry storms, timezone drift — are documented in the migration playbook, so check there first. For conversion help, tracker access, or to dispute a decommission date, contact the platform pod by email.

escalation mailbox, bafog-fafog: ulador@paliqlabs.internal

Build provenance: Digest Scheduler (Lanternmail). Every deploy of the batch email digest scheduler is built in the sealed pipeline and signed before promotion; unsigned artifacts must never be rolled out, even during an incident. When paged for digest delays, first confirm the running artifact matches the attested release record. The currently attested provenance token is recorded below.

trace token, bagug-yahof: htk21_2d0de668956bdbfbe66bf

Alert: Incremental rebuild lag on Pressline. This fires when the Pressline static site's incremental rebuild queue falls more than fifteen minutes behind content publishes. It usually means the content webhook from Quillbase is stalled or the rebuild worker pool is saturated. Don't panic — stale pages are served from cache, so readers are unaffected. Triage steps and dashboard links live on our internal runbook page.

runbook for badug-kadup: https://confluence.zemvarlabs.internal/projects/browse/display/projects/bd1b